Talan Products, Cleveland, OH, a full-service metal-stamping company and manufacturer of tooling and engineered parts, has received a 2015 Evolution of Manufacturing Award presented by Smart Business magazine. Talan (www.talanproducts.com) was honored for its achievements in manufacturing, including its commitment to safety and efficiency in its manufacturing processes. The company’s incident rate decreased from nearly 20 in 2006 to zero in 2014. Over the same span, its DART rate (days away, restrictions, transfers) decreased from 10 to zero. Talan has maintained a DART rate of zero since 2013.

Talan’s commitment to efficiency is demonstrated in its investment in new equipment. The company purchased a remanufactured 600-ton Minster Hevi-Stamper press, to go online in the spring. The press will be paired with a new deburring machine capable of handling stampings to 14 in. dia. Both new machines will be installed as part of a new production line that will allow Talan to bring previously outsourced work inhouse.

“We are extremely honored to receive a 2015 Evolution of Manufacturing Award,” says Talan CEO Steve Peplin. “It’s a tremendous source of pride for us, because it has come as the result of hard work and commitment from all of our people as we continue to work to maintain high standards in everything we do and continue taking steps to increase the ease of doing business with Talan.”

Talan was among 10 companies honored at the 2015 Evolution of Manufacturing Conference Feb. 19 at the Advanced Technology Training Center on the Metro Campus of Cuyahoga Community College.
